We weigh all silver rolls. 90% Silver coin, whether dimes, quarters or half dollars weighs 125g per $5 face value or 250g per $10 face value. The 2 dime rolls together weigh almost 251g as seen in the pictures.

 

Using Aluminum Foil was a common practice of the 1960s and early 1970s used by many roll collectors or hoarders believing the foil helped to keep the coins from toning and helping to maintain a fresh, original look. I will say the pigmentation on the roll itself is very bright and vibrant so the aluminum foil, being wrapped around the paper of the roll, appears to have helped preserve the paper in addition to the end of roll coins, which are a bright silver, freshly minted look.
